自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(20)
  • 收藏
  • 关注

原创 appium入门案例

有可能会对->None产生疑问,这是标注方法的返回值。

2024-07-17 18:17:47 122

原创 shell脚本中文乱码

要解决在Xshell中粘贴中文乱码的问题,首先需要确定乱码的原因。通常,这可能与终端的字符编码设置、Xshell的配置或者远程Linux服务器的locale设置有关。以下是一个简单的bash脚本,该脚本尝试设置Linux系统的locale为支持中文的编码(如。),但请注意,这个脚本可能并不能直接解决所有情况下的乱码问题,因为乱码的原因可能多种多样。

2024-07-04 19:54:24 663

原创 bash写脚本遇到提示“坏的解释器,没有那个文件或目录”

root@master restapi-teach]# ./install.sh -bash: ./install.sh: /bin/bash^M: 坏的解释器: 没有那个文件或目录这个错误通常是因为你的install.sh脚本是在 Windows 系统下编写的,或者在 Windows 和 Linux 之间通过文本编辑器或者某些不恰当的传输方式(如直接通过 FTP)传输时,文件行尾符(EOL)被错误地转换成了 Windows 风格的\r\n(回车+换行),而 Linux 系统期望的是\n(仅换行)。

2024-07-04 19:44:31 589

原创 CentOS 7 官方支持和停止维护后系统可能大量出现问题,比如cannot find a valid baseurl for repo:base/7/x86_64

然后:wget -O /etc/yum.repos.d/CentOS-Base.repo http://mirrors.aliyun.com/repo/Centos-7.repo。执行:mv /etc/yum.repos.d/CentOS-Base.repo /etc/yum.repos.d/CentOS-Base.repo.backup。直接访问:http://mirrors.aliyun.com/repo。直接参考换源链接即可。

2024-07-04 18:14:44 184

原创 CentOS 7 官方支持和停止维护时间,目前已经停止维护

在输出中查找 CentOS Linux release 7 相关信息,如果看到类似 Vault: EOL 的字样,说明系统已经停止维护。如果你需要延长系统的支持寿命,考虑升级到更新的操作系统版本,如 CentOS Stream 或者转换到其他支持更长期的发行版,如 Rocky Linux 或 AlmaLinux。如果系统提示 timedatectl 命令未找到,可能是因为你使用的是较旧的系统或者系统中缺少 timedatectl 工具。2024年6月30日后,CentOS 7 将不再提供更新和支持。

2024-07-04 18:11:06 945

原创 CentOS版Linux安装python3

以上步骤会在CentOS系统中安装Python 3.8或3.10.,可以选择保留系统中原有的Python版本。使用python3.8来运行Python 3.8,而python或python2将继续指向系统中的默认Python 2版本。需要的话就安装,不许不执行:sudo yum groupinstall -y "Development Tools"注意: 如果使用make altinstall,而不是make install可以避免覆盖默认的Python版本。注:需要安装3.10.0,只更改3.8.0即可。

2024-07-04 16:07:06 604

原创 appium命令行安装(非UI)

当您安装Appium 1时,所有可用的驱动程序会与主Appium服务器一起安装。仅安装Appium 2(例如,通过`npm i -g appium`)只会安装Appium服务器,但不会安装驱动程序。为了安装驱动程序,您现在必须使用新的Appium扩展CLI。如果您遇到安装或启动错误,请先卸载任何现有的Appium 1 npm包(使用`npm uninstall -g appium`)。Android:appium driver install uiautomator2 # 安装最新版本的驱动。

2024-06-26 11:29:28 370

原创 appium的元素定位(你可以知道最新的元素定位的写法)

appium的元素定位新写法。

2024-06-26 08:56:43 141

原创 Appium真机测试问题

AttributeError: 'NoneType'object has no attribute 'to_capabilities'错误

2024-06-26 08:50:44 305

原创 Node.js安装

除了npm之外,还有其他的包管理工具可供选择,如yarn和pnpm。这些工具提供了更快的安装速度和更好的性能。如果你需要,可以在命令行中运行相应的命令来安装它们。由于npm默认的源位于国外,可能导致国内下载速度较慢。可以将npm源更换为淘宝的npm镜像源,以提高下载速度。选择适合你电脑硬件架构的版本(如32-bit、64-bit、ARM64等)。通过以上步骤,你就可以成功安装并配置好Node.js环境了。五、更换npm源为淘宝镜像(可选)六、安装其他包管理工具(可选)二、安装Node.js。

2024-06-24 11:40:03 244

原创 Java后端全栈开发路线

Java后端全栈开发是一个涵盖多个技术和领域的综合性工作,它要求开发者具备从数据库设计、后端服务开发到系统部署和优化的全方位能力。总之,Java后端全栈开发是一个综合性很强的工作,需要开发者具备广泛的技术知识和实践经验。通过不断学习和实践,可以不断提升自己的技能水平,为企业创造更大的价值。

2024-06-20 18:33:34 543

原创 官网下载JMeter太慢了,来使用清华源下载

总结:使用清华源下载JMeter主要是确定下载地址、选择并下载、安装和运行JMeter。如果需要,还可以配置清华源作为pip或conda的源来加速其他包的下载。如果你在使用Anaconda或Miniconda,并且希望使用清华源来加速conda包的下载,可以按照参考文章1中的步骤来配置。但同样,这一步与下载JMeter无关,只是提供了使用清华源加速conda包下载的额外信息。但请注意,这一步与下载JMeter无关,只是提供了使用清华源加速pip包下载的额外信息。根据你的需求选择合适的JMeter版本。

2024-06-20 17:04:04 975 3

原创 第一阶段 软件测试基础

力度:开发一般是想办法实现功能,对自己的代码比较心疼,测试没有那么暴力,专业测试是需要全方位测试的,比较暴力。测试是为了了解软件是否满足客户的需求,不同的客户对象要求的级别不一样,测试的级别也不一样。随着时代的发展,对软件的要求不局限于功能是否完整,而且还需要有更好的体验。软件从无到有,经历了很多不同的阶段,为了保证软件质量需要对软件进行测试;b、按授权分:开源软件,免费软件,公共软件,专属软件,共享软件。项目经理、产品经理、架构师、软件工程师、测试工程师。专业度:开发和测试方向不同,专人做专事;

2024-06-20 14:35:00 135

原创 软件测试从0~N

熟练使用各种测试工具,如Selenium WebDriver、JMeter、Postman、Appium等。:学习如何使用自动化测试框架,如Selenium、TestNG、Cucumber等。:学习使用脚本语言,如Bash、PowerShell等,以自动化测试流程。:理解敏捷开发流程,如Scrum、Kanban,并在测试中应用敏捷原则。:学习软件测试的基本概念,包括测试生命周期、测试策略、测试设计技术等。:理解不同类型的测试,如功能测试、性能测试、安全测试、可用性测试等。

2024-06-20 13:55:28 283

原创 后端开发工具

Cloud Toolkit:一个集成开发环境(IDE)插件,支持多种IDE(如IntelliJ IDEA、Eclipse、PyCharm等),可以帮助开发人员更有效地开发、测试、诊断和部署应用程序。Git:一款分布式版本控制系统,用于跟踪和管理代码的变更,帮助开发人员更好地管理代码版本、协作开发、回滚不必要的更改,并进行分支管理。Swagger:用于构建、文档和测试API的开源工具,支持OpenAPI规范,并生成详细的API文档。Java:Spring框架是Java后端开发的代表性工具之一。

2024-06-20 13:48:01 301

原创 被MySQL折磨了很久的总结,本地MySQL配置全过程

MySQL本地配置及常见问题和解决方法

2023-03-20 10:10:06 91

原创 Java 学习路线

Java 全新路线深入扎实的核心編码能力传统单体应用到互联网架构能力深入掌握 DevOps 核心技术

2023-03-17 15:14:38 158

原创 项目三 基于A*搜索算法迷宫游戏开发

1.迷宫游戏是非常经典的游戏,在该题中要求随机生成一个迷宫,并求解迷宫;2.要求游戏支持玩家走迷宫,和系统走迷宫路径两种模式。玩家走迷宫,通过键盘方向键控制,并在行走路径上留下痕迹;系统走迷宫路径要求基于A*算法实现,输出走迷宫的最优路径并显示。3.设计交互友好的游戏图形界面。...

2021-12-16 23:01:40 1400

原创 项目二 贪吃蛇

class Point { int x; int y; public Point(int x, int y) { this.x = x; this.y = y; }}

2021-12-12 22:27:37 2950

原创 项目一 计算器

计算器项目

2021-11-25 15:19:55 757

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除